Karachi: The Islamic State of Iraq and Syria (ISIS) has reportedly released a new audio tape featuring its Afghanistan leader, Hafiz Saeed, challenging reports that he was killed in a U.S. drone strike.
The message from Saeed was posted on an ISIS website two days after the Afghan intelligence agency said that the Mumbai terror blasts mastermind had been killed in the Achin district of Nangarhar province, reported the Dawn.
